Shake shingle repair services involve fixing or replacing damaged or deteriorated shake shingles on a property's roof or exterior walls. This process typically includes inspecting the shingles to identify issues such as cracks, splits, warping, or missing pieces, and then carefully repairing or replacing the affected shingles to restore the integrity and appearance of the surface. Skilled service providers use specialized techniques and materials to ensure that repairs blend seamlessly with existing shingles, helping to maintain the property's overall look and functionality.

These services help address common problems like leaks, water intrusion, and further structural damage caused by compromised shingles. Over time, exposure to weather elements such as rain, wind, and sun can cause shake shingles to weaken or break down. Repairing these issues promptly can prevent more extensive damage, such as rotting wood or mold growth, which can lead to costly repairs down the line. Shake shingle repair also helps improve the energy efficiency of a property by maintaining proper insulation and preventing drafts that can result from damaged shingles.

Properties that often benefit from shake shingle repair include historic homes, cottages, cabins, and other residential buildings with traditional or rustic exteriors. These structures typically feature shake shingles as a key element of their aesthetic appeal, making timely repairs essential to preserve their character. Commercial properties with similar architectural styles may also require shake shingle services to maintain their visual integrity and protect the underlying structure from the elements.

The overview below groups typical Shake Shingle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- for minor shake shingle repairs,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ine fixes fall within this range, though costs can vary based on the extent of damage and material costs.

Moderate Repairs - larger, more involved repairs such as replacing multiple shingles or sections generally cost between $600 and $1,500. These projects are common and often fall into the middle price range for local service providers.

Full Shingle Replacement - replacing an entire section or the full roof with shake shingles can range from $3,000 to $8,000 or more. Larger projects tend to push into higher tiers, especially for extensive or complex roofing systems.

Full Roof Replacement - complete shake shingle roof replacements usually start around $8,000 and can reach $15,000+ depending on size and complexity. Many local contractors handle projects in this range, though fewer fall into the highest cost brackets.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are shake shingle repairs? Shake shingle repairs involve fixing damaged or deteriorated wooden shingles to restore the roof's appearance and function. Local contractors can assess the extent of damage and perform necessary replacements or repairs.

How can I tell if my shake shingles need repair? Signs include curling, cracking, missing shingles, or areas where shingles have become soft or moldy. A professional inspection can determine if repairs are needed.

What types of shake shingle repair services are available? Services typically include replacing broken or missing shingles, sealing leaks, and addressing wood rot or mold issues. Local service providers can recommend appropriate solutions based on the condition of the shingles.

Are shake shingle repairs suitable for all types of roofs? Shake shingle repairs are generally suitable for homes with wood shingle roofing. A local contractor can evaluate whether repair is appropriate or if replacement might be necessary.

How do local contractors handle shake shingle repair projects? Contractors typically assess the damage, prepare the work area, replace or repair shingles as needed, and ensure the roof maintains its integrity and appearance.
